Posted on 9/10/11 at 10:31 pm to Modern
quote:
Ok, whats a good realm to play in...I chose RvPvP...i want the full experience
The way it is now, your best bet is to level up on a normal or RP server then switch to a PVP server if that is your wish.
You can change realms every three days, for $25, if that is your wish. I just gave one of my nephews my 70 elemental shaman and it cost me $25 to switch realms, then another $25 after the three day cool to switch accounts.
